Chapter Eighty-six

Ron looked at the man in front of him, who had buried his head back in a stack of documents and a sigh escaped his lips. He had become a shadow of his old self since his wife died three years ago. He had now become distant and cold, just like he was before he got married. The day his wife died, it was like a dark cloud had descended over the entire family.

He was lost in his own grief, unable to find solace and move forward. The office became tense and morale plummeted. Damian would snap at anyone who annoyed him.

Everything had gone back to the way they were before Maya came into their lives. Damian, who wasn't able to stay in the house located in the city moved back to the isolated house his grandfather had built. The house wasn't far away from the bustling city and was surrounded by thick tree and bushes.
